Spotlight Recipes: Stone Fruit

Peaches with Balsamic Cherries

Ellie's Peaches with Balsamic Cherries

These fruit from the Rosaceae family contain a single hard seed or pit (a.k.a. a stone). They include some of our summer faves like cherries, plums, peaches and apricots. Enjoy your favorites in these mouth-watering recipes.
